FM inaugurates Sri Lanka - German Business
Council in Frankfurt |
|
|
|
The Sri Lanka – German Business Council
established on the initiative of the
Consulate General of Sri Lanka in Frankfurt
was inaugurated by Foreign Minister Rohitha
Bogollagama on August 21 at the Marriot
Hotel in Frankfurt, Germany.
The Business Council has been established to
bring together Sri Lankan and German
businessmen engaged in trade between the two
countries. Minister Bogollagama speaking to
the business community expressed the hope
that this forum would help to enhance
connectivity given the tremendous potential
in increasing bilateral trade.
The Foreign Minister further highlighted the
trade and Investment opportunities in Sri
Lanka and made particular reference to the
GSP+ scheme of the EU, as well as a avenues
available to German investors wanting to
make Sri Lanka a base to enter the vast
South Asian markets under the Free Trade
Agreements with India and Pakistan. He
emphasized the special focus of Sri Lankan
Missions abroad in promoting economic
diplomacy.
